Monitoring of Glaucoma



Specialized eye treatment experts utilize a complex technique in the management of glaucoma, a dynamic eye problem characterized by optic nerve damage and possible vision loss. The main goal of taking care of glaucoma is to stop more damages to the optic nerve and protect the patient's vision. Therapy options for glaucoma commonly include eye goes down to minimize intraocular pressure, laser therapy to improve drain of liquid from the eye, and sometimes, medical interventions to develop alternate pathways for liquid outflow.


Normal tracking and follow-up appointments are crucial in taking care of glaucoma effectively. Specialized eye care professionals utilize numerous analysis tools such as aesthetic area examinations, optical coherence tomography (OCT), and tonometry to evaluate the development of the condition and change therapy strategies accordingly. In addition, individual education plays an important role in the monitoring of glaucoma, as people need to comprehend the value of sticking to their prescribed therapy program and participating in arranged appointments to prevent irreparable vision loss. By implementing an extensive administration method, specialized eye care professionals can aid clients with glaucoma maintain their aesthetic function and lifestyle.




Role in Macular Deterioration

Playing a crucial role in the discovery and monitoring of macular degeneration, specialized eye treatment specialists utilize sophisticated diagnostic devices and treatment modalities to resolve this dynamic retinal illness. Macular deterioration, likewise called age-related macular degeneration (AMD), postures a substantial hazard to vision, specifically in older adults. By utilizing tools like optical coherence tomography (OCT) and fundus digital photography, eye care professionals can precisely diagnose the type and severity of macular deterioration in individuals.


When diagnosed, specialized eye care specialists play an essential function in managing macular deterioration by providing therapy alternatives such as anti-vascular endothelial development factor (anti-VEGF) injections, photodynamic therapy, and laser surgical procedure. With their experience and personalized care, specialized eye care specialists add dramatically to improving the high quality of life for people influenced by this sight-threatening problem.

Usual Refractive Errors





Refractive errors, such as myopia, hyperopia, and astigmatism, prevail vision conditions that impact the quality of vision. Myopia, also referred to as nearsightedness, triggers far-off challenge appear blurred, while hyperopia, or farsightedness, makes close-up things challenging to see clearly. Astigmatism causes altered or blurry vision in any way distances as a result of an irregularly designed cornea.


These refractive mistakes happen when the shape of the eye prevents light from concentrating straight on the retina, causing blurred vision. Myopia is generally caused by the eyeball being too long, hyperopia by the eyeball being also brief, and astigmatism by an unequal curvature of the cornea or lens.


Thankfully, these common refractive mistakes can be dealt with via different techniques such as prescription eyeglasses, contact lenses, or refractive surgery like LASIK. By addressing these aesthetic disabilities, individuals can experience better quality and intensity of vision, inevitably improving their general lifestyle. Normal eye tests are essential for spotting and managing these problems to preserve ideal eye wellness.

Corneal Disorders



Commonly impacting the outermost layer of the eye, corneal disorders incorporate a selection of conditions that can affect vision and total eye wellness. The cornea, a clear dome-shaped surface area covering the front component of the eye, plays an essential function in concentrating light and protecting the eye from particles and infection. When the cornea is impacted by problems such as keratoconus, corneal abscess, or dystrophies like Fuchs' endothelial dystrophy, it can lead to signs like fuzzy vision, pain, level of sensitivity to light, and in serious cases, vision loss.


Keratoconus is a progressive thinning of the cornea that results in a cone-like lump, distorting vision. Corneal abscess, often created by infections or injuries, can lead to soreness, discharge, and serious pain. Fuchs' endothelial dystrophy affects the back layer of the cornea, resulting in fluid buildup and cloudy vision.


Treatment for corneal conditions varies depending upon the specific condition however may consist of medicines, corneal cross-linking, or in serious instances, corneal transplant surgical procedure to bring back vision and relieve signs. Regular eye tests are necessary for early discovery and management of corneal disorders to maintain vision wellness.

The wellness of the retina, an essential layer of tissue lining the rear of the eye that is necessary for look at this website visual handling, is extremely important for preserving optimum vision and general eye feature. Retinal conditions encompass a wide variety of disorders that can dramatically influence vision. Typical retinal conditions consist of age-related macular deterioration (AMD), diabetic person retinopathy, retinal detachment, and retinitis pigmentosa.


Age-related macular deterioration is a leading source of vision click to find out more loss in individuals over 50, affecting the macula in the center of the retina. Diabetic retinopathy, a complication of diabetes mellitus, problems blood vessels in the retina and can lead to loss of sight if left without treatment. Retinal detachment takes place when the retina peels off away from its underlying tissue, causing unexpected vision loss that needs immediate medical interest. Retinitis pigmentosa is a congenital disease that causes a steady loss of vision because of deterioration of the retina's light-sensitive cells.
